Santo Domingo. – The one-year-old baby identified as Ruth Angélica Mota Martínez, found dead inside a backpack in a ravine in the Los Girasoles sector, had died due to cerebral hypoxia caused by cerebral edema, according to the death certificate issued by the National Institute of Forensic Sciences (Inacif).
According to the preliminary report, the forensic experts determined that the cause of death corresponds to a condition compatible with cerebral asphyxia, so the case was initially classified as a homicide. Forensic authorities specified that this result is part of a preliminary evaluation, as the definitive conclusion will depend on the complementary studies of the autopsy, the results of which will be ready within an estimated period of 45 days.
